73 /* ----------------------- Start implementation -----------------------------*/
74 #if MB_MASTER_RTU_ENABLED > 0 || MB_MASTER_ASCII_ENABLED > 0
75 #if MB_FUNC_READ_COILS_ENABLED > 0
76 
77 /**
78  * This function will request read coil.
79  *
80  * @param ucSndAddr salve address
81  * @param usCoilAddr coil start address
82  * @param usNCoils coil total number
83  * @param lTimeOut timeout (-1 will waiting forever)
84  *
85  * @return error code
86  */
87 eMBMasterReqErrCode
eMBMasterReqReadCoils(UCHAR ucSndAddr,USHORT usCoilAddr,USHORT usNCoils,LONG lTimeOut)88 eMBMasterReqReadCoils( UCHAR ucSndAddr, USHORT usCoilAddr, USHORT usNCoils ,LONG lTimeOut )
89 {
90     UCHAR                 *ucMBFrame;
91     eMBMasterReqErrCode    eErrStatus = MB_MRE_NO_ERR;
92 
93     if ( ucSndAddr > MB_MASTER_TOTAL_SLAVE_NUM ) eErrStatus = MB_MRE_ILL_ARG;
94     else if ( xMBMasterRunResTake( lTimeOut ) == FALSE ) eErrStatus = MB_MRE_MASTER_BUSY;
95     else
96     {
97 		vMBMasterGetPDUSndBuf(&ucMBFrame);
98 		vMBMasterSetDestAddress(ucSndAddr);
99 		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_FUNC_OFF]                 = MB_FUNC_READ_COILS;
100 		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_READ_ADDR_OFF]        = usCoilAddr >> 8;
101 		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_READ_ADDR_OFF + 1]    = usCoilAddr;
102 		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_READ_COILCNT_OFF ]    = usNCoils >> 8;
103 		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_READ_COILCNT_OFF + 1] = usNCoils;
104 		vMBMasterSetPDUSndLength( MB_PDU_SIZE_MIN + MB_PDU_REQ_READ_SIZE );
105 		( void ) xMBMasterPortEventPost( EV_MASTER_FRAME_SENT );
106 		eErrStatus = eMBMasterWaitRequestFinish( );
107 
108     }
109     return eErrStatus;
110 }
111 
112 eMBException
eMBMasterFuncReadCoils(UCHAR * pucFrame,USHORT * usLen)113 eMBMasterFuncReadCoils( UCHAR * pucFrame, USHORT * usLen )
114 {
115     UCHAR          *ucMBFrame;
116     USHORT          usRegAddress;
117     USHORT          usCoilCount;
118     UCHAR           ucByteCount;
119 
120     eMBException    eStatus = MB_EX_NONE;
121     eMBErrorCode    eRegStatus;
122 
123     /* If this request is broadcast, and it's read mode. This request don't need execute. */
124     if ( xMBMasterRequestIsBroadcast() )
125     {
126     	eStatus = MB_EX_NONE;
127     }
128     else if ( *usLen >= MB_PDU_SIZE_MIN + MB_PDU_FUNC_READ_SIZE_MIN )
129     {
130     	vMBMasterGetPDUSndBuf(&ucMBFrame);
131         usRegAddress = ( USHORT )( 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_READ_ADDR_OFF] << 8 );
132         usRegAddress |= ( USHORT )( 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_READ_ADDR_OFF + 1] );
133         usRegAddress++;
134 
135         usCoilCount = ( USHORT )( 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_READ_COILCNT_OFF] << 8 );
136         usCoilCount |= ( USHORT )( 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_READ_COILCNT_OFF + 1] );
137 
138         /* Test if the quantity of coils is a multiple of 8. If not last
139          * byte is only partially field with unused coils set to zero. */
140         if( ( usCoilCount & 0x0007 ) != 0 )
141         {
142         	ucByteCount = ( UCHAR )( usCoilCount / 8 + 1 );
143         }
144         else
145         {
146         	ucByteCount = ( UCHAR )( usCoilCount / 8 );
147         }
148 
149         /* Check if the number of registers to read is valid. If not
150          * return Modbus illegal data value exception.
151          */
152         if( ( usCoilCount >= 1 ) &&
153             ( ucByteCount == pucFrame[MB_PDU_FUNC_READ_COILCNT_OFF] ) )
154         {
155         	/* Make callback to fill the buffer. */
156             eRegStatus = eMBMasterRegCoilsCB( &pucFrame[MB_PDU_FUNC_READ_VALUES_OFF], usRegAddress, usCoilCount, MB_REG_READ );
157 
158             /* If an error occured convert it into a Modbus exception. */
159             if( eRegStatus != MB_ENOERR )
160             {
161                 eStatus = prveMBError2Exception( eRegStatus );
162             }
163         }
164         else
165         {
166             eStatus = MB_EX_ILLEGAL_DATA_VALUE;
167         }
168     }
169     else
170     {
171         /* Can't be a valid read coil register request because the length
172          * is incorrect. */
173         eStatus = MB_EX_ILLEGAL_DATA_VALUE;
174     }
175     return eStatus;
176 }
177 #endif

179 #if MB_FUNC_WRITE_COIL_ENABLED > 0
180 
181 /**
182  * This function will request write one coil.
183  *
184  * @param ucSndAddr salve address
185  * @param usCoilAddr coil start address
186  * @param usCoilData data to be written
187  * @param lTimeOut timeout (-1 will waiting forever)
188  *
189  * @return error code
190  *
191  * @see eMBMasterReqWriteMultipleCoils
192  */
193 eMBMasterReqErrCode
eMBMasterReqWriteCoil(UCHAR ucSndAddr,USHORT usCoilAddr,USHORT usCoilData,LONG lTimeOut)194 eMBMasterReqWriteCoil( UCHAR ucSndAddr, USHORT usCoilAddr, USHORT usCoilData, LONG lTimeOut )
195 {
196     UCHAR                 *ucMBFrame;
197     eMBMasterReqErrCode    eErrStatus = MB_MRE_NO_ERR;
198 
199     if ( ucSndAddr > MB_MASTER_TOTAL_SLAVE_NUM ) eErrStatus = MB_MRE_ILL_ARG;
200     else if ( ( usCoilData != 0xFF00 ) && ( usCoilData != 0x0000 ) ) eErrStatus = MB_MRE_ILL_ARG;
201     else if ( xMBMasterRunResTake( lTimeOut ) == FALSE ) eErrStatus = MB_MRE_MASTER_BUSY;
202     else
203     {
204 		vMBMasterGetPDUSndBuf(&ucMBFrame);
205 		vMBMasterSetDestAddress(ucSndAddr);
206 		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_FUNC_OFF]                = MB_FUNC_WRITE_SINGLE_COIL;
207 		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_WRITE_ADDR_OFF]      = usCoilAddr >> 8;
208 		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_WRITE_ADDR_OFF + 1]  = usCoilAddr;
209 		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_WRITE_VALUE_OFF ]    = usCoilData >> 8;
210 		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_WRITE_VALUE_OFF + 1] = usCoilData;
211 		vMBMasterSetPDUSndLength( MB_PDU_SIZE_MIN + MB_PDU_REQ_WRITE_SIZE );
212 		( void ) xMBMasterPortEventPost( EV_MASTER_FRAME_SENT );
213 		eErrStatus = eMBMasterWaitRequestFinish( );
214     }
215     return eErrStatus;
216 }
217 
218 eMBException
eMBMasterFuncWriteCoil(UCHAR * pucFrame,USHORT * usLen)219 eMBMasterFuncWriteCoil( UCHAR * pucFrame, USHORT * usLen )
220 {
221     USHORT          usRegAddress;
222     UCHAR           ucBuf[2];
223 
224     eMBException    eStatus = MB_EX_NONE;
225     eMBErrorCode    eRegStatus;
226 
227     if( *usLen == ( MB_PDU_FUNC_WRITE_SIZE + MB_PDU_SIZE_MIN ) )
228     {
229         usRegAddress = ( USHORT )( pucFrame[MB_PDU_FUNC_WRITE_ADDR_OFF] << 8 );
230         usRegAddress |= ( USHORT )( pucFrame[MB_PDU_FUNC_WRITE_ADDR_OFF + 1] );
231         usRegAddress++;
232 
233         if( ( pucFrame[MB_PDU_FUNC_WRITE_VALUE_OFF + 1] == 0x00 ) &&
234             ( ( pucFrame[MB_PDU_FUNC_WRITE_VALUE_OFF] == 0xFF ) ||
235               ( pucFrame[MB_PDU_FUNC_WRITE_VALUE_OFF] == 0x00 ) ) )
236         {
237             ucBuf[1] = 0;
238             if( pucFrame[MB_PDU_FUNC_WRITE_VALUE_OFF] == 0xFF )
239             {
240                 ucBuf[0] = 1;
241             }
242             else
243             {
244                 ucBuf[0] = 0;
245             }
246             eRegStatus =
247                 eMBMasterRegCoilsCB( &ucBuf[0], usRegAddress, 1, MB_REG_WRITE );
248 
249             /* If an error occured convert it into a Modbus exception. */
250             if( eRegStatus != MB_ENOERR )
251             {
252                 eStatus = prveMBError2Exception( eRegStatus );
253             }
254         }
255         else
256         {
257             eStatus = MB_EX_ILLEGAL_DATA_VALUE;
258         }
259     }
260     else
261     {
262         /* Can't be a valid write coil register request because the length
263          * is incorrect. */
264         eStatus = MB_EX_ILLEGAL_DATA_VALUE;
265     }
266     return eStatus;
267 }
268 
269 #endif

271 #if MB_FUNC_WRITE_MULTIPLE_COILS_ENABLED > 0
272 
273 /**
274  * This function will request write multiple coils.
275  *
276  * @param ucSndAddr salve address
277  * @param usCoilAddr coil start address
278  * @param usNCoils coil total number
279  * @param usCoilData data to be written
280  * @param lTimeOut timeout (-1 will waiting forever)
281  *
282  * @return error code
283  *
284  * @see eMBMasterReqWriteCoil
285  */
286 eMBMasterReqErrCode
eMBMasterReqWriteMultipleCoils(UCHAR ucSndAddr,USHORT usCoilAddr,USHORT usNCoils,UCHAR * pucDataBuffer,LONG lTimeOut)287 eMBMasterReqWriteMultipleCoils( UCHAR ucSndAddr,
288 		USHORT usCoilAddr, USHORT usNCoils, UCHAR * pucDataBuffer, LONG lTimeOut)
289 {
290     UCHAR                 *ucMBFrame;
291     USHORT                 usRegIndex = 0;
292     UCHAR                  ucByteCount;
293     eMBMasterReqErrCode    eErrStatus = MB_MRE_NO_ERR;
294 
295     if ( ucSndAddr > MB_MASTER_TOTAL_SLAVE_NUM ) eErrStatus = MB_MRE_ILL_ARG;
296     else if ( usNCoils > MB_PDU_REQ_WRITE_MUL_COILCNT_MAX ) eErrStatus = MB_MRE_ILL_ARG;
297     else if ( xMBMasterRunResTake( lTimeOut ) == FALSE ) eErrStatus = MB_MRE_MASTER_BUSY;
298     else
299     {
300 		vMBMasterGetPDUSndBuf(&ucMBFrame);
301 		vMBMasterSetDestAddress(ucSndAddr);
302 		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_FUNC_OFF]                      = MB_FUNC_WRITE_MULTIPLE_COILS;
303 		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_WRITE_MUL_ADDR_OFF]        = usCoilAddr >> 8;
304 		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_WRITE_MUL_ADDR_OFF + 1]    = usCoilAddr;
305 		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_WRITE_MUL_COILCNT_OFF]     = usNCoils >> 8;
306 		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_WRITE_MUL_COILCNT_OFF + 1] = usNCoils ;
307 		if( ( usNCoils & 0x0007 ) != 0 )
308         {
309 			ucByteCount = ( UCHAR )( usNCoils / 8 + 1 );
310         }
311         else
312         {
313         	ucByteCount = ( UCHAR )( usNCoils / 8 );
314         }
315 		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_WRITE_MUL_BYTECNT_OFF]     = ucByteCount;
316 		ucMBFrame += MB_PDU_REQ_WRITE_MUL_VALUES_OFF;
317 		while( ucByteCount > usRegIndex)
318 		{
319 			*ucMBFrame++ = pucDataBuffer[usRegIndex++];
320 		}
321 		vMBMasterSetPDUSndLength( MB_PDU_SIZE_MIN + MB_PDU_REQ_WRITE_MUL_SIZE_MIN + ucByteCount );
322 		( void ) xMBMasterPortEventPost( EV_MASTER_FRAME_SENT );
323 		eErrStatus = eMBMasterWaitRequestFinish( );
324     }
325     return eErrStatus;
326 }
327 
328 eMBException
eMBMasterFuncWriteMultipleCoils(UCHAR * pucFrame,USHORT * usLen)329 eMBMasterFuncWriteMultipleCoils( UCHAR * pucFrame, USHORT * usLen )
330 {
331     USHORT          usRegAddress;
332     USHORT          usCoilCnt;
333     UCHAR           ucByteCount;
334     UCHAR           ucByteCountVerify;
335     UCHAR          *ucMBFrame;
336 
337     eMBException    eStatus = MB_EX_NONE;
338     eMBErrorCode    eRegStatus;
339 
340     /* If this request is broadcast, the *usLen is not need check. */
341     if( ( *usLen == MB_PDU_FUNC_WRITE_MUL_SIZE ) || xMBMasterRequestIsBroadcast() )
342     {
343     	vMBMasterGetPDUSndBuf(&ucMBFrame);
344         usRegAddress = ( USHORT )( pucFrame[MB_PDU_FUNC_WRITE_MUL_ADDR_OFF] << 8 );
345         usRegAddress |= ( USHORT )( pucFrame[MB_PDU_FUNC_WRITE_MUL_ADDR_OFF + 1] );
346         usRegAddress++;
347 
348         usCoilCnt = ( USHORT )( pucFrame[MB_PDU_FUNC_WRITE_MUL_COILCNT_OFF] << 8 );
349         usCoilCnt |= ( USHORT )( pucFrame[MB_PDU_FUNC_WRITE_MUL_COILCNT_OFF + 1] );
350 
351         ucByteCount = 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_WRITE_MUL_BYTECNT_OFF];
352 
353         /* Compute the number of expected bytes in the request. */
354         if( ( usCoilCnt & 0x0007 ) != 0 )
355         {
356             ucByteCountVerify = ( UCHAR )( usCoilCnt / 8 + 1 );
357         }
358         else
359         {
360             ucByteCountVerify = ( UCHAR )( usCoilCnt / 8 );
361         }
362 
363         if( ( usCoilCnt >= 1 ) && ( ucByteCountVerify == ucByteCount ) )
364         {
365             eRegStatus =
366                 eMBMasterRegCoilsCB( &ucMBFrame[MB_PDU_REQ_WRITE_MUL_VALUES_OFF],
367                                usRegAddress, usCoilCnt, MB_REG_WRITE );
368 
369             /* If an error occured convert it into a Modbus exception. */
370             if( eRegStatus != MB_ENOERR )
371             {
372                 eStatus = prveMBError2Exception( eRegStatus );
373             }
374         }
375         else
376         {
377             eStatus = MB_EX_ILLEGAL_DATA_VALUE;
378         }
379     }
380     else
381     {
382         /* Can't be a valid write coil register request because the length
383          * is incorrect. */
384         eStatus = MB_EX_ILLEGAL_DATA_VALUE;
385     }
386     return eStatus;
387 }
388 
389 #endif
390 #endif
